A cross-sectional survey was conducted among 677 nurses from 4 hospitals in 4 countries (Afghanistan, Ghana, Iran, and Uganda).
The findings revealed that there are significant differences between the 3 EBP subscales (that is, practice/use, attitude, and knowledge/skill) across the 4 countries (
Nurses in the 4 countries have moderate practice, attitude, and knowledge/skills of EBP. Nurses in LMICs require continuous professional development programs and support to enhance their practice and knowledge regarding EBP in clinical settings.
